About the Role

The Contract Administrator is responsible for developing, maintaining, and expanding our Provider Network. This role will be actively engaged in negotiations with various provider types to ensure the continued delivery of high-quality healthcare services.

To be successful in this role, you:

  • Have a minimum of two (2) years of experience in contracting and/or contract management in Managed Care required.
  • Have a minimum of four (4) years of experience in contracting and servicing providers in an insurance setting, hospital, Behavioral Health environment, or other clinical settings, including working with physician groups, ancillary providers, and behavioral health agencies preferred.
  • Have familiarity with Washington State Provider Networks and managed care operations.
  • Have a desire to bring your skills and knowledge to a dynamic team of healthcare professionals and enjoy contributing to offering access to healthcare services for individuals throughout Washington State
  • This position may require occasional travel. You must have a current driver’s license, an acceptable driving record, and proof of automobile insurance.

Essential functions and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Negotiate hospital, physician groups, ancillary providers, and behavioral health agency contracts, and other provider types as needed.
  • Initiate and maintain productive long-term relationships with Provider Networks and other agencies serving Community Health Plan of Washington (CHPW) enrollees.
  • Perform contracting negotiation using reimbursement strategies that are aligned with CHPW objectives and meet the needs of the provider communities.
  • Develops and uses effective cost and utilization reports for the administration of contracted relationships.
  • Ensure provider negotiations and contracts are managed in a way that is complaint with various regulatory agencies, i.e., the Office of the Insurance Commissioner (OIC), Health Care Authority (HCA), and Centers for Medicaid and Medicare Services (CMS).
  • Assures maintenance of accurate, current, detailed files with important provider information.
  • Proactively identifies and addresses gaps in the Provider Network to improve member access and meet CHPW’s network adequacy and regulatory requirements.
  • Communicate proactively and effectively with internal and external business partners.Participates and reviews CHPW’s policies and procedures that impact provider
  • relations and contracting.
  • Other duties as assigned. Essential functions listed are not necessarily exhaustive and may be revised by the employer, at its sole discretion.

      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:

      • Knowledge of various reimbursement strategies and methodologies used by State and Federal programs such as Washington State Health Care Authority and Centers for Medicaid and Medicare Services.
      • Knowledge of network development and network adequacy requirements imposed by regulatory agencies having oversite of managed care plans.
      • Excellent oral and written communication skills.
      • Skilled in the use of Microsoft Office products, including Outlook,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.
      • Skilled in the use of collaboration tools such as Microsoft Teams, SharePoint, and Smartsheet.
      • Ability to organize work and the ability to focus on detail.
      • Ability to meet scheduled deadlines with minimal supervision.
